Recording Cilia Activity in Ctenophores

  • Tigran P. Norekian,
  • Leonid L. Moroz

摘要

Pelagic ctenophores swim in the water with the help of eight rows of long fused cilia. Their entire behavioral repertoire is dependent to a large degree on coordinated cilia activity. Therefore, recording cilia beating is paramount to understanding and registering the behavioral responses and investigating its neural and hormonal control. Here, we present a simple protocol to monitor and quantify cilia activity in semi-intact ctenophore preparations (using Pleurobrachia and Bolinopsis as models), which includes a standard electrophysiological setup for intracellular recording.
